BE PART OF THE CONNECTION
Are you ready to assist in planning, forecasting, and implementing highly complex network systems? As a Network Engineer III at Spectrum, you will design protocol compatibility standards, develop network enhancements, recommend improvements, and be responsible for implementing network architecture and designs.
WHAT OUR NETWORK ENGINEER III ENJOY THE MOST
  • Participate in network planning, network architecture design and engineering.
  • Integrate and schematically depict communication architectures, topologies, hardware, software, transmission and signaling links and protocols into complete network configurations.
  • Evaluate new products, perform network problem resolution.
  • Assist in the development and documentation of technical standards.
  • Develop and implement approved methods of procedure.
  • Design and establish protocol compatibility standards, develop and implement network enhancements and make recommendations for improvement.
  • Work on projects/systems/issues of medium to high complexity surrounding network planning, configuration and optimization
  • Provide escalated tier support across organizations and to third party vendors.
  • Work on one or more projects as a project team member, occasionally as a project team lead.
  • Adhere to industry specific local, state, and federal regulations, as applicable.

WHAT YOU'LL BRING TO SPECTRUM
Required Qualifications
  • Experience
    • Five (5+) years Data Network experience.
  • Education
    •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or related field or equivalent work experience .
  • Technical Skills
    • Demonstrated in-depth knowledge of related industry specifications and standards IEEE, ANSI, Fiber (Multimode, Single mode, UTP, etc.), Bridging, Switching, Routing, Ethernet and Transport technologies and protocols .
    • Demonstrated in-depth knowledge in network design, network architecture, network protocols, network topology, network devices, and network appliances.
    • Demonstrated in-depth knowledge in using ticketing and software tools to support the current operations.
    • Demonstrated in-depth knowledge of network designing software, such as Visio.
  • Skills and Abilities
    • Ability to read, write and speak the English language .
    • Ability to use personal computer and software applications like Microsoft Office.
    • Demonstrated in-depth data networking knowledge (OSI Model, TCP/IP, Optical Transport).
    • Ability to work in a team environment, perform duties in a very fast-paced environment and ability to learn new technology quickly.

Preferred Education
  • Cisco Certified Network Professional (CCNP ).
  • Industry and vendor specific certifications and training (Cisco, Juniper, Alcatel-Lucent, etc.).
  • Knowledge of company products and services.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
